Having a Baby?
In York County, you are not alone. According to the United States Census Bureau, an estimated 2,200 births were expected in 1999 and the numbers keep on growing.
At Goodall Hospital, our Women's and Birthing Center, opened in February, 2000, showcases our commitment to York County families.
The center features home-like décor, modern conveniences and the latest in technology to make expectant mothers and families feel comfortable and secure. More importantly, our skilled, compassionate staff with an average of 15 years experience will listen to your needs to create a personalized approached to one of life's most important and treasured moments.
All of our rooms are "Labor, Delivery, Recovery and Post-Partum rooms" meaning that once you are settled in, you and your baby won't have to move until you are both sent home.

Other important program features include:
- Nurse Call System: When you ring the call button, a signal will be transmitted directly to your nurse, eliminating the noisy overhead paging system and ensuring personalized care and service.
- Family Center: This a a comfortable place to wait, relax, watch TV or enjoy a light snack
- "Code Alert" Infant Security: Each infant is fitted with a band that houses a tiny transmitter. If someone attempts to leave the unit with the baby, an alarm will immediately sound.
- Post-Partum Care Center: We will check on both you and your baby a few days after your delivery.
- Certified Lactation Counselors, who provide a combination of practical knowledge and the latest research-based teaching.
